The History and Myth of How Many Tons is a Cruise Ship

The concept of how many tons is a cruise ship dates back to the early days of ocean travel. In the past, ships were often measured in terms of their gross tonnage, which referred to the volume of the ship's enclosed spaces. This measurement was used to calculate various fees and taxes, as well as to determine the ship's capacity for passengers and cargo.

Over time, the measurement of a ship's weight and size has evolved, and today, cruise ships are typically measured in terms of their gross tonnage and their deadweight tonnage. Gross tonnage refers to the total internal volume of the ship, while deadweight tonnage refers to the weight that a ship can safely carry, including passengers, crew, and cargo.

As for the myth surrounding how many tons is a cruise ship, there is a common misconception that a ship's weight determines its stability. While it's true that a heavier ship may have more stability in certain conditions, stability is actually determined by a combination of factors, including the ship's design, ballast systems, and other safety features.
